Rolling in Treasures Full Review

Rolling in Treasures Overview

Rolling in Treasures digs into familiar mining and treasure themes with a mechanical twist: every tumble cascades new symbols onto the grid, stacking multipliers with each consecutive win. The 6×5 layout uses scatter-pays mechanics, meaning symbol clusters anywhere on the grid trigger wins—no fixed paylines required. With a max win ceiling of 5000x and high volatility, this is a slot engineered for variance rather than steady returns.

How Rolling in Treasures Works

The core gameplay revolves around the Tumble Mechanic. When a win lands, those symbols disappear and new ones fall into place. If the new symbols create another win, the process repeats—and critically, a multiplier overlay increases with each consecutive tumble. This is where the mechanical complexity emerges: players don't simply chase isolated wins; the layout rewards clusters that chain together.

With a bet range of $0.2 to $240, the slot accommodates both conservative players and those seeking higher swings. The scatter-pays system removes the rigid structure of traditional paylines, allowing wins to form from any cluster position, which theoretically increases the variety of winning combinations compared to fixed-line alternatives.

Volatility sits at 5/5—the maximum tier. This means payout distributions are heavily weighted toward infrequent, larger wins rather than steady small returns. Long dry spells between wins should be expected as the statistical norm. The RTP of 96.5% (with variants at 95.5% and 94.5% depending on your region) represents the theoretical house edge over infinite spins; individual sessions will deviate dramatically in either direction.

Rolling in Treasures Bonus Features

Multiplier Overlay Feature

This is the slot's primary mechanic differentiator. When tumbles occur, the multiplier increments with each cascade. Instead of wins resetting to 1x after each cascade, the multiplier persists and grows—meaning a four-tumble chain multiplies the final win by a higher factor than a two-tumble chain. The overlay visually stacks on the grid, showing accumulating multipliers. This mechanic explains how the theoretical max win reaches 5000x: long tumble chains compound multipliers exponentially.

Tumble Mechanic

After each win, winning symbols vanish and new symbols fall to fill empty spaces. If the new arrangement creates another win, the tumble repeats. The tumble continues until no more wins form. This creates potential for extended sequences where a single spin triggers multiple payouts in succession. The Multiplier Overlay intensifies with each tumble, so lengthy sequences generate outsized final multipliers compared to short ones.

Free Spins

Scatter symbols trigger Free Spins rounds. The feature grants a preset number of free spins during which the tumble and multiplier mechanics remain active. Free Spins provide a dedicated environment for the multiplier overlay to accumulate across multiple spins without wagering additional funds between them. However, they're subject to the same high variance—long sequences are possible but not guaranteed.

Rolling in Treasures Bonus Buy Options

Pragmatic Play offers three bonus buy tiers, each costing a multiple of your current bet and guaranteeing access to Free Spins with modified mechanics:

Free Spins (100x cost)

Triggering normal Free Spins with 4–6 bonus symbols guaranteed. This is the baseline bonus buy—it locks in a Free Spins round without waiting for scatter triggers. The cost is 100x your bet; mathematically, this should be weighed against the probability of naturally triggering Free Spins. The RTP remains at 96.5%, indicating the payout structure accounts for the premium.

Super Free Spins 1 (250x cost)

Here, multipliers increase by +3x per tumble instead of the standard +1x. This accelerated multiplier growth means short tumble sequences generate larger multipliers faster. The cost is 250x your bet, and RTP holds at 96.5%. The mechanic trades cost for multiplier acceleration—theoretically enabling higher final multipliers over the same number of tumbles compared to standard Free Spins.

Super Free Spins 2 (1000x cost)

The premium tier starts multipliers at x2 and doubles them with each tumble (x2, x4, x8, x16... up to x256). This is exponential rather than additive. At 1000x your bet, this option represents a significant investment. The RTP shifts fractionally to 96.55%, reflecting the mechanic's payout profile. The doubling formula means just 5–6 tumbles can reach the x256 cap, concentrating massive multipliers into short sequences.

Bonus buys are mechanical options, not financial strategies. Each costs real money and should be evaluated purely on preference for gameplay style. None guarantees increased returns—they redistribute variance differently across the spin.

Rolling in Treasures Verdict

Rolling in Treasures is engineered for players comfortable with extended dry spells in exchange for mechanically complex tumble sequences and exponential multiplier scaling. The bonus buy options cater to different risk tolerances, but none mitigate the underlying high volatility. This slot is best suited to experienced players who understand variance and enjoy grid-based cascade mechanics similar to [Divine Drop](/slots/divine-drop) or [Cubes 2](/slots/cubes-2).

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the RTP of Rolling in Treasures?
Rolling in Treasures has an RTP of 96.5%, with regional variants available at 95.5% and 94.5%. The RTP represents the theoretical average payout over an infinite number of spins. All three bonus buy options (Free Spins, Super Free Spins 1, and Super Free Spins 2) maintain RTP values at or near 96.5%, meaning the bonus mechanics do not improve long-term return rates—they alter variance distribution instead.
What is the maximum win in Rolling in Treasures?
The theoretical maximum win in Rolling in Treasures is 5000x your bet. This ceiling is derived from the combination of the Multiplier Overlay Feature and extended tumble sequences, which can accumulate high multipliers over consecutive wins. Reaching this theoretical max is extremely unlikely and should not be expected as a realistic outcome.
What is the volatility of Rolling in Treasures?
Rolling in Treasures has maximum volatility at 5/5. High volatility means payouts are distributed infrequently and heavily skewed toward larger wins, resulting in long periods without significant returns. Players should expect extended dry spells as the statistical norm when playing this slot.
How does the Multiplier Overlay Feature work in Rolling in Treasures?
The Multiplier Overlay Feature increases the multiplier with each consecutive tumble. When winning symbols disappear and new symbols fall into place, if they create another win, the tumble repeats and the multiplier grows. This allows multipliers to compound across multiple cascades within a single spin sequence, with longer tumble chains generating higher final multipliers.
What bet range does Rolling in Treasures offer?
Rolling in Treasures supports a bet range from $0.2 to $240 per spin, accommodating a wide range of stake preferences. The bonus buy options are calculated as multiples of your current bet (e.g., 100x, 250x, or 1000x), so your chosen bet level directly affects the cost of accessing bonus buy tiers.
What is the difference between the three bonus buy options in Rolling in Treasures?
The three bonus buy options modify Free Spins mechanics at different costs. Free Spins (100x cost) uses standard multiplier scaling (+1x per tumble). Super Free Spins 1 (250x cost) increases multipliers by +3x per tumble, accelerating growth. Super Free Spins 2 (1000x cost) starts at x2 and doubles multipliers with each tumble (x2, x4, x8, etc., up to x256). Each option maintains an RTP around 96.5%, meaning cost differences reflect preference for variance profile, not return rates.
What does the Tumble Mechanic do in Rolling in Treasures?
The Tumble Mechanic causes winning symbols to disappear and new symbols to fall into empty spaces. If the newly fallen symbols create another win, the tumble repeats. This cascade continues until no more wins form on a single spin. Tumbles activate the Multiplier Overlay, allowing multipliers to accumulate across the entire sequence, which is how long chains generate the slot's highest multipliers.
